Roberto Cuca - Insider Trading & Ownership

Entity
Individual
Location
C/O Trevena, Inc., 1018 West 8 Th Avenue, Suite A, King Of Prussia, Pennsylvania
Summary
The estimated net worth of Roberto Cuca is at least $1.58 M dollars as of February 27, 2024. Roberto Cuca is the CFO of ORASURE TECHNOLOGIES INC and owns shares of ORASURE TECHNOLOGIES INC (OSUR) stock worth about $940 K. Roberto Cuca is the COO and CFO of TELA Bio, Inc. and owns shares of TELA Bio, Inc. (TELA) stock worth about $635 K.
All Insider Reports
All Insider Reports

Ownership of Roberto Cuca

Symbol Company Relationship Holdings Value Past Year Net Change Change % Report Period
OSUR ORASURE TECHNOLOGIES INC Cfo $940 K May 7, 2021
TELA TELA Bio, Inc. COO and CFO $635 K +$44.9 K +7.61% Feb 23, 2024

Insider Transactions Reported by Roberto Cuca:

Sym Company Class Transaction % Value $ Price $ Shares Shares After Date Ownership